Public bug reported:

I was using gnome-terminal on Ubunutu 14.04 when it crashed.  When the
crash notification message box appeared ("submit dump", etc.) there was
an option to relaunch the terminal.  I chose this option.

Git started exhibiting strange behaviours when trying to clone
repositories, claiming it did not have permission even if ran within a
directory with 777.  Eventually I realised it may be a terminal issue
and when I closed it and opened a new one from the launcher the
permissions error disappeared.
